5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ings many advantages, it isn't without its challenges. The major disadvantages is the potential for fraudulent activ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, where players cheat to gain an unfair benefit. However, reputable online poker platforms use robust safety measures and random number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Also, some players might find the absence of physical cues and communications which can be section of real time poker games a disadvantage, as it can be more difficult to read through opponents and use mental tactics on the web.
